Crystal Palace star Darren Anmbrose has called for young gun Wilfried Zaha to remain at the club.
The 18-year old Ivorian-born England U19 international is attracting plenty of interest from Premier League clubs but Ambrose would love to see him stay at Selhurst Park as he has so much to offer, like recently-departed Victor Moses.
"It's no surprise to see him linked with other clubs," said Ambrose of the striker.
"But Victor (Moses) didn't get much playing time at Wigan last year, although he's come in now.
"It would be nice to keep Wilfried here because he is a great player for us."
